What separates the Taima Classic Pan Pro from standard non-stick options begins with its fundamental construction. This pan features 100% pure medical-grade titanium with zero PFAS, PTFE, or synthetic coatings—a stark contrast to conventional non-stick surfaces that rely on chemical layers to achieve their slippery properties. The pan’s SlipScale technology represents a different approach entirely: a natural non-stick surface engineered without chemical additives, relying instead on the inherent properties of titanium itself.

Beyond the surface lies a titanium cooking experience backed by a lifetime warranty, antibacterial properties inherent to the material, and a non-reactive cooking surface that won’t leach compounds into your food. Hands-On Performance: How the SlipScale Surface Actually Cooks

Testing the Taima pan revealed that its non-stick capability is genuinely achievable when properly preheated with minimal oil. The real-world performance differs markedly from traditional non-stick pans, requiring a shift in cooking technique rather than a straightforward plug-and-play experience.

Heat Distribution Across the 2mm Titanium Base

The 2mm titanium construction creates noticeable heat distribution patterns. The pan conducts heat rapidly once preheated, but uneven hotspots emerge more readily than with thicker cookware. Searing and browning results prove respectable when you account for these distribution quirks, though achieving the restaurant-quality crust that traditional non-stick pans promise requires more deliberate technique.

Preheating Requirements and the Learning Curve

Optimal performance demands proper preheating—typically 2-3 minutes over medium heat before adding oil or food. This requirement represents the steepest part of the learning curve. Many home cooks accustomed to grabbing their old non-stick pan and cooking immediately find this adjustment frustrating initially. However, once this rhythm becomes habit, the process flows naturally.

Cooking Versatility Across Different Foods

The pan handles proteins effectively, particularly when preheated adequately. Vegetables cook with good browning potential. Eggs present a more challenging scenario—they stick more readily than with traditional non-stick surfaces unless oil quantity is generous. This versatility comes with conditions, making the pan less forgiving than conventional alternatives but capable of handling most weeknight cooking tasks.

Build Quality and Durability: Medical-Grade Titanium Under the Microscope

Pure Titanium Construction and Medical-Grade Standards

Medical-grade titanium means this material meets strict purity and quality standards typically reserved for surgical implants and dental work. The titanium used in the Taima pan undergoes rigorous testing to ensure absence of harmful contaminants. This level of refinement explains part of the premium pricing—you’re purchasing material quality that extends far beyond typical cookware specifications.

Scratch-Resistance and Long-Term Surface Integrity

Pure titanium exhibits exceptional scratch-resistance. Unlike ceramic non-stick surfaces that chip and peel readily with metal utensils, the Taima pan’s surface withstands aggressive scrubbing and metal utensil use without degradation. After months of testing with metal spatulas and cooking utensils, the surface remains visually unchanged and performs identically to day one.

Rivetless Interior Design for Easier Cleaning

The pan’s interior features a rivetless design—a thoughtful construction choice that eliminates crevices where food particles accumulate. Cleaning becomes genuinely easier compared to traditional pans with riveted handles. This design detail contributes significantly to long-term maintenance ease and hygiene.

Weight Distribution and Handling Comfort

The titanium construction keeps the pan remarkably lightweight despite its durability. Weight distribution feels balanced during extended cooking sessions, reducing hand fatigue. However, the handle presents a separate consideration—its smooth finish becomes slippery when wet or greasy, requiring careful grip adjustments during cooking.

Oven and Stovetop Compatibility

The pan transitions seamlessly between stovetop and oven, including induction cooktops. This versatility makes it genuinely useful for recipes requiring both stovetop searing and oven finishing. The lack of compatibility limitations removes a frustration point that plagues many specialty cookware pieces.

The Honest Drawbacks: Where the Taima Classic Pan Pro Falls Short

Thin 2mm Construction and Heat Retention

The 2mm thickness represents the most significant performance compromise. This construction leads to poor heat retention compared to thicker cookware. The pan cools noticeably once you add room-temperature ingredients, requiring ongoing heat adjustments. For recipes demanding steady, consistent heat—like searing steaks or maintaining high-temperature stir-frying—this drawback becomes genuinely problematic.

Uneven Heat Distribution Challenges

Heat spreads unevenly across the cooking surface due to the thin construction. The center heats faster than the edges, creating hotspots that affect cooking precision. Recipes requiring careful temperature control suffer most from this characteristic.

Handle Design and Grip Issues

The handle’s smooth titanium finish becomes genuinely slippery when wet or greasy—a safety concern during active cooking. Toweling off your hands frequently or using a silicone grip becomes necessary for secure handling during meal preparation.

Learning Curve for Consistent Results

Achieving non-stick results demands proper preheating and oil usage—a more demanding combination than traditional non-stick cookware requires. New users frequently experience sticking on their first several attempts, leading to frustration before they adjust their technique and expectations.

Price Point and Value Proposition

At $174, the pan costs significantly more than budget-friendly alternatives. This investment becomes justified only if you commit to the learning curve and value the health benefits of chemical-free cooking. For casual home cooks or those unwilling to adjust their cooking methods, the price barrier may feel prohibitive.

Practical Cooking Tips: Maximizing Your Taima Pan’s Potential

Proper Preheating Techniques

Heat the pan over medium heat for 2-3 minutes before cooking. You’ll know it’s ready when water droplets form beads and roll across the surface rather than spreading. This visual test confirms the pan has reached optimal temperature for non-stick cooking.

Oil Selection and Quantity

Use adequate oil—typically a thin coating across the entire cooking surface. High-smoke-point oils like avocado or grapeseed oil perform better than olive oil, which can break down under the heat required for proper preheating. Don’t skimp on oil quantity in pursuit of healthier cooking; the pan’s performance depends on it.

Temperature Management Strategies

Once food hits the pan, resist the urge to constantly move it. Allow proteins to develop a crust before flipping. Use medium heat rather than high heat to maximize the thin pan’s heat retention capability. Lower temperatures require more patience but deliver more consistent results than aggressive high-heat cooking.

Cleaning Methods for Surface Integrity

Hand washing works best, though the pan is dishwasher safe. Gentle scrubbing with warm soapy water suffices for most cooking residue. Avoid abrasive scouring pads despite the titanium’s durability—simple soap and water maintain the surface optimally.

Seasoning Routines for Long-Term Performance

Occasional light seasoning with oil enhances long-term non-stick capability. After cleaning, apply a thin oil layer to the cooking surface while still warm, then wipe away excess. This practice gradually builds improved non-stick properties over months of use.

The Bottom Line: Verdict on the Taima Pure Titanium Classic Pan Pro

The Taima Pure Titanium Classic Pan Pro stands as a legitimate option for anyone serious about eliminating chemical coatings from their kitchen. Its medical-grade titanium construction, lifetime warranty, and genuine non-stick capability deliver real value—but only if you understand what you’re actually buying. This isn’t a plug-and-play replacement for your old non-stick pan; it’s a commitment to a different cooking philosophy that demands patience, proper technique, and realistic expectations.

The 2mm thickness creates genuine heat retention challenges, and the learning curve is steeper than manufacturers suggest. Yet for health-conscious home cooks willing to invest time in mastering the pan’s quirks, the durability and chemical-free cooking surface justify the $174 price tag. If you’re replacing worn-out non-stick cookware and genuinely care about avoiding PFAS and PTFE exposure, the Taima Classic Pan Pro deserves serious consideration.

Just approach it with eyes wide open about the performance trade-offs, commit to proper preheating and oil usage, and you’ll likely find it becomes a kitchen staple for years to come.
